Abstract

This study aims to develop Islamic text-based reading materials with a Genre-Based Approach as teaching materials for compulsory subjects for Islamic University students. The study used a Research and Development approach, where the data were collected through questionnaires and interviews. Qualitative data were analyzed using interactive analysis and quantitative data analysis used percentages. The research participants consisted of lecturers and 50 students from the Islamic Education Department. The data were collected through questionnaires and interviews. The result of this study indicated that designing Islamic text-based reading teaching materials with a genre-based approach is exceedingly needed. The content of the book consists of the following components: cover, preface, table of content, explanation text, recount text, descriptive text, narrative text, discussion text, hortatory text, news item text, references, and about the writer. Furthermore, the student's responses to the teaching materials designed were 0% disagreed, 13% less agreed, 52% agreed, and 35% strongly agreed. The average score is 3.22 and, if converted on a table with a scale of 4, includes it in a very good category. Therefore, an Islamic text-based reading material with a genre-based approach is worth applying by the students of the Islamic Education Department.
